MySQL开启远程登录以及关闭权限_mysqk怎么关闭ssh登录_计算机V的博客-程序员秘密

技术标签: 1024程序员节  mysql  数据库  

MySQL开启远程登录以及关闭权限

方法一:

开启远程:

step1: 登录MySQL数据库

[[email protected] ~]# mysql -uroot -p
Enter password: 
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is 78
Server version: 5.7.23 MySQL Community Server (GPL)

Copyright (c) 2000, 2018, Oracle and/or its affiliates. All rights reserved.

Oracle is a registered trademark of Oracle Corporation and/or its
affiliates. Other names may be trademarks of their respective
owners.

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.

mysql> 

step2: 修改权限

第一个root是用户名,后面一个root是数据库密钥, %表示所有主机都可以访问。

m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root' WITH GRANT OPTION;

step3: 刷新权限

mysql> flush privileges;
Query OK, 0 rows affected (0.22 sec)

mysql> 

step4: 查看权限

mysql> use mysql
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A

sDatabase changed
mysql> select user, host from user;
+---------------+-----------+
| user          | host      |
+---------------+-----------+
| root          | %         |
| mysql.session | localhost |
| mysql.sys     | localhost |
| root          | localhost |
+---------------+-----------+
4 rows in set (0.09 sec)

mysql> 

关闭远程:

delete from user where user='root' and host='%';

方法二:

开启远程:

step1: 修改表user

mysql> use mysql; 
mysql> update user set host = ‘%’ where user = ‘root’;

step2: 刷新权限

mysql> flush privileges;
Query OK, 0 rows affected (0.22 sec)

mysql> 

关闭远程:

mysql> use mysql; 
mysql> update user set host = ‘localhost’ where user = ‘root’;

mysql> flush privileges;
Query OK, 0 rows affected (0.22 sec)

mysql> 

最后
在bind-address=127.0.0.1前加上”#”号注释掉,表示允许所有的ip连接(43行)
[email protected]:/etc/mysql/mysql.conf.d# chmod 777 mysqld.cnf

参考

https://blog.csdn.net/dengjin20104042056/article/details/95091506

版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
本文链接:https://blog.csdn.net/weixin_43959022/article/details/120392691

智能推荐

Android恶意代码分析流程,【技术分享】Android恶意软件分析_weixin_39865061的博客-程序员秘密

预估稿费:200RMB(不服你也来投稿啊!)投稿方式:发送邮件至linwei#360.cn,或登陆网页版在线投稿目的这个练习涵盖了技术分析Android恶意软件通过使用一个定制的恶意软件样本在Android设备上运行时,将会reverse shell给一个攻击者。我们将通过使用静态和动态分析技术分析完整功能应用程序。虚拟机使用:Santoku Linux VM工具:AVD Manager, ADB...

国产动漫详细列表_cpongo3的博客-程序员秘密

国产动漫详细列表动漫名称来源跟新时间描述斗罗大陆第二季腾讯视频每周六由唐家三少的同名小说改编而成,内容切合小说原著万界神主腾讯视频每周三 周六虽然有点短,但是挺好看的狐妖小红娘腾讯视频每周五国产中算是比较好看的动漫...

java并发编程之CompletionService_My_Vina的博客-程序员秘密

(转自:https://blog.csdn.net/u010185262/article/details/56017175 侵删)应用场景当向Executor提交多个任务并且希望获得它们在完成之后的结果,如果用FutureTask,可以循环获取task,并调用get方法去获取task执行结果,但是如果task还未完成,获取结果的线程将阻塞直到task完成,由于不知道哪个task优先执行完毕,使用这...

C# Linq多表查询多参数排序_ciixcxy521659的博客-程序员秘密

两表 SQL to Linq SQL: strQuery = "SELECT A.*, B.LABEL_DESC FROM LBLMATREL A, LBLDEF B" + " WHERE A.FACTORY = B.FAC...

日期时间工具类_sheng_xinjun的博客-程序员秘密

package com.util;import java.text.ParseException;import java.text.SimpleDateFormat;import java.util.Calendar;import java.util.Date;import java.util.regex.Matcher;import java.util.regex.Patter...

随便推点

Java实战之管家婆记账系统(4)——用户注册及登录功能实现_fxml中如何注册按钮_二木成林的博客-程序员秘密

首先使用IDEA创建一个普通的JavaFX项目,并按照下图创建文件夹。接着是引入要使用的第三方包,需要用到的包在file文件夹下的jar包中,引入即可。在引入成功后,数据库表的创建已经在第二节文章中讲述了,并且file文件夹下的sql包中存在着可以直接执行的SQL语句,以此来创建数据库表。第一步:根据数据库表结构创建实体类,如下图所示。同时tools包下有两个在项...

康娜的二叉树_Merry2004的博客-程序员秘密

题目描述九月月赛的时候,康娜学会了一种叫做线段树的数据结构。现在她发现了另外一个维护序列的数据结构。这棵二叉树的每个节点维护一对权值,记作 (a,b) 。这棵树满足任意父亲节点的 a 一定大于他的任何一个子孙节点的 a;对于任意节点,必然满足右儿子节点的 b < 这个节点自己的 b < 左儿子节点的 b。现在给你一个数列 x ,设a=x[i], b=i,用这个数列建立这种二叉树。可以保证这种二叉树的结构是唯一的。现在康娜建好了这棵树,她开始好奇另一个问题:对于这棵树上的任意一个点,将

Git 文件跟踪_37号楼梯的博客-程序员秘密

.gitignore只追踪.h 和.cpp结尾的文件。*.*!*.cpp!*.h 我们一般写的形式为“ git push origin &amp;lt;src&amp;gt;:&amp;lt;dst&amp;gt; ”,冒号前表示local branch的名字,冒号后表示remote repository下 branch的名字。注意,如果你省略了&amp;lt;dst&amp;gt;,git就认为你想push到remote re...

c语言flash里能存文件吗,STM32内部FLASH打包读写_宋简单的博客-程序员秘密

最近做到的项目在运行需要把一组uint8_t(unsigned char)的数据进行掉电储存,想到单片机STM32f030f4p6内部flash可以直接由程序操作,写了以下代码用于uint8_t数据打包保存和读取。1、程序清单 与 测试结果本程序包含5个文件,分别是:1、Flash.c:内部flash读取储存相关函数2、Flash.h:flash头文件3、USART1.c:STM32F030F4P...

JS对象,JSON_llkaidaotumi的博客-程序员秘密

对象万物皆对象字面量书写格式:关键字 标识符 赋值符号 大括号 分号let obj = {} ;例子:let iphone ={name:`HW`,size:5.0,price:9999,};对象初始化let obj ={属性名1:属性值1,属性名2:属性值2,属性名3:属性值3,属性名4:属性值4,};键值对键:属性名值:属性值变量称为属性,函数称为方法注:冒号右侧是否是函数【增,删,改,查】增对.

Matlab之魔方阵magic_magic matlab_星尘亦星辰的博客-程序员秘密

1、函数功能magic函数是用于创建魔方阵。魔方阵的特点是:每行每列以及对角线的元素之和相等的方阵。2、代码示例clc;clear all;A = magic(4)sum(A(1,:)) %求第一行的元素之和sum(A(:,1)) %求第一列的元素之和sum(diag(A)) %求对角线的元素之和,diag函数生成主对角线元素的向量运行结果:...

推荐文章

热门文章

相关标签